Proper noun[edit]

Todger

  1. A male nickname.
    • 1905, George Bernard Shaw, Major Barbara:
      Will you box Todger Fairmile if I put him on to you?
    • 1917, William Hathorn Mills, War-ballads and Verses:
      "TODGER" - it hardly seems a name
      To claim a place on the scroll of fame;
      'Tis a hero's name, all the same.
      He's Thomas A. Jones officially,
      But "Todger" is the name that he goes by
